This eighth issue of Cimoc, a Spanish comic magazine published by Norma Editorial in 1989, collects a selection of serialized stories and features typical of the anthology format. It includes contributions from various creators, offering a mix of genres and continuing the magazine's tradition of showcasing both local and international comic talent.
A 1989 issue from Norma Editorial's Cimoc series, "Tamat" features artwork and writing by Oswal, with additional writing by Yaqui, and a cover by Fernando Rubio.
